Iron Mountain Inc. announced the expansion of its European services with the acquisition of the archive services business of IBM Deutschland GmbH subsidiary DISOS.

This most recent acquisition enhances Iron Mountain's offering of records management services by adding nine records centers in five new markets; Berlin, Stuttgart, Leipzig, Dresden and Erfurt, to Iron Mountain's existing German operations.
"This deal is strategic to Iron Mountain's continued European growth," said Ken Radtke, president of Iron Mountain Europe. "DISOS brings an experienced management team and knowledgeable workforce to a strong existing business that will help us to expand our service offerings within this important market. We welcome the customers and employees of DISOS to our growing German business."
